FIGUEIREDO, Cláudia. The Stage of Mars: Representations of the First World War and its Social Effects on Portuguese Dramaturgy. e-JPH [online]. 2013, vol.11, n.2, pp.74-92. ISSN 1645-6432.

The theme of the First World War and its effects on European arts and literature is a theme that has already been widely explored, most notably in the theatrical field. Taking as its starting point a set of plays written both during the early stages of the war and in the postwar period, this article examines the evolution of attitudes towards the conflict in the dramaturgy produced in Portugal, paying particular attention to two main areas of influence: the traumatic nature of the conflict and the specificities of the national historical context.

Palabras clave : Great War; Theatre; Culture; Perceptions; Discourses.
